Nutritional Powerhouse: A Closer Look at Raw Cabbage

Raw cabbage is often regarded as a nutritional powerhouse, offering a wide range of essential vitamins and minerals that contribute significantly to overall health. One of the standout nutrients in cabbage is vitamin K, which plays a crucial role in blood clotting and bone health. A sufficient intake of vitamin K can help maintain bone density and reduce the risk of fractures. Furthermore, raw cabbage is rich in vitamin C, an antioxidant that enhances the immune system and promotes skin health while also contributing to the absorption of iron from other foods.

In addition to these vitamins, raw cabbage boasts an impressive array of phytonutrients, including glucosinolates, which have been shown to possess anti-cancer properties. These compounds work to detoxify the body and reduce the risk of certain diseases. The high fiber content found in raw cabbage also supports digestive health by promoting regular bowel movements and preventing constipation. Groundnuts: The Nutty Boost to Your Diet

Groundnuts, commonly known as peanuts, are not only a beloved snack but also a remarkable source of nutrition. They are an excellent source of healthy fats, protein, and antioxidants, which are essential for maintaining overall health. Incorporating groundnuts into your diet can enhance the health benefits of eating cabbage with groundnuts and banana, creating a balanced and nutritious meal.

One of the key nutritional benefits of groundnuts is their composition of mono- and polyunsaturated fats, which are known to support heart health. These healthy fats can help lower bad cholesterol levels while increasing good cholesterol, thus reducing the risk of heart disease. Additionally, the protein content in groundnuts contributes to muscle repair and growth, making them a valuable component for those looking to maintain or increase their protein intake.

Groundnuts are also rich in antioxidants such as resveratrol, which is believed to have various health benefits, including protection against chronic diseases. Furthermore, they contain essential vitamins and minerals, including magnesium, vitamin E, and folate, which play critical roles in bodily functions and overall well-being.

With regard to weight management, groundnuts can promote feelings of fullness and satiety, which may help control appetite and reduce unnecessary snacking. When combined with raw cabbage, the high fiber content of both ingredients can further enhance digestion and promote a healthy gut.

Incorporating groundnuts into daily meals is easy; they can be added to salads, blended into smoothies, or enjoyed as a standalone snack. However, it is essential to be mindful of potential allergies, as peanut allergies are quite common. Bananas: The Sweet Partner for Digestive Health

Bananas, often heralded for their delightful sweetness and creamy texture, play a crucial role in enhancing the health benefits of eating cabbage with groundnuts. Packed with dietary fiber, bananas contribute significantly to digestive health, ensuring smooth bowel movements and preventing constipation. The soluble fiber found in bananas helps to regulate the digestive system by forming a gel-like substance in the gut, which aids in the absorption of nutrients. This characteristic makes the combination of bananas with raw cabbage and groundnuts not only a flavor-packed dish but also a digestive powerhouse.

Additionally, bananas are an excellent source of potassium, an essential mineral that helps maintain fluid balance in the body and supports muscle function. Potassium-rich diets can also lead to lower blood pressure levels, contributing to overall cardiovascular health. Coupled with the vitamins found in bananas, such as Vitamin C and Vitamin B6, this fruit contributes to enhanced energy levels and a boost in immune function.

Understanding the Ingredients: Raw Onion, Garlic, and Ginger

Raw onion, garlic, and ginger are integral components in various culinary traditions, renowned not only for their flavors but also for their extensive health benefits. Each ingredient possesses a unique nutritional profile and bioactive compounds that contribute to an array of health advantages, making them pivotal in the practice of unlocking health through dietary choices.

Starting with raw onions, they are low in calories yet rich in crucial nutrients such as vitamin C, B vitamins, and potassium. They are significant sources of quercetin, a potent antioxidant that is believed to reduce inflammation and bolster heart health. Their potential to strengthen the immune system and improve digestive health makes them a popular choice for consumption, particularly when eaten raw. In various cultures, onions symbolize hospitality and are commonly used in a multitude of dishes, showcasing their versatility.

Garlic, another powerhouse ingredient, contains allicin, a compound that exhibits antimicrobial and anti-inflammatory properties. Additionally, it is an excellent source of vitamins C and B6, manganese, and selenium. Garlic is often lauded for its role in boosting cardiovascular health, lowering blood pressure, and enhancing the immune response. Across cultures, garlic is celebrated for its health benefits and culinary prowess, often regarded as a sacred ingredient with protective qualities.

Finally, ginger stands out for its complex flavor profile and unique properties. It contains gingerol, a bioactive compound known for its antioxidant and anti-inflammatory effects. Ginger is frequently used to aid digestion, relieve nausea, and mitigate muscle pain. In various cultures, ginger holds a significant place in traditional medicine, often regarded as a remedy for ailments ranging from colds to digestive issues.

Precautions and Considerations When Eating Raw Onion, Garlic, and Ginger

While incorporating raw onion, garlic, and ginger into one's diet can provide numerous health benefits, particularly when consumed on an empty stomach, it is essential to approach these foods with caution. Each of these ingredients is highly potent and may cause adverse effects for certain individuals or when consumed in excessive amounts. Understanding these precautions can help ensure a safe and beneficial addition to one's dietary regimen.

Individuals with digestive disorders, such as ir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) or g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D), should be particularly cautious. Raw onion and garlic can exacerbate symptoms like bloating, gas, and heartburn. Additionally, ginger, while often touted for its digestive aid properties, can be irritating to some individuals when consumed in excess, leading to discomfort. It is advisable for those with pre-existing gastrointestinal issues to consult a healthcare professional before introducing these foods into their routine.

Furthermore, people taking certain medications should exercise caution. Garlic, for instance, is known for its blood-thinning properties and may interact with anticoagulant medications, potentially increasing the risk of bleeding. Similarly, individuals on antidiabetic drugs might find that raw garlic can enhance insulin sensitivity, hence affecting blood sugar levels. It is crucial for individuals on such medications to discuss their dietary choices with a healthcare provider to avoid any possible interactions.

Incorporating these foods into a balanced diet is key. Moderation is essential when consuming raw onion, garlic, and ginger. Consider starting with small amounts to gauge how the body responds and adjusting accordingly. Optimizing health through diet should always prioritize safe consumption practices.
